Sourdough for a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in contrast, is often celebrated for its nutritional Positive aspects. Built by way of a all-natural fermentation procedure, sourdough provides a decreased glycemic index as compared to other breads, which means it's got a slower impact on blood sugar degrees. This can make it a far better option for retaining energy ranges all over the school day.

Additionally, the fermentation process in sourdough breaks down a lot of the gluten and phytic acid while in the flour, making it much easier to digest and enhancing the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ough for a nutritious choice for school foods, significantly when produced with complete gr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Cost and Preparation Challenges
Although sourdough features a lot of health Positive aspects, its integration into เรียนทำขนม UFM university foodstuff courses will not be with out issues. A single important barrier is Price tag. Sourdough bread, specifically when designed with high-high quality, natural and organic elements, might be more expensive than commercially produced bread. This makes it difficult for educational facilities, In particular These with restricted budgets, to offer sourdough regularly.

A further challenge is planning. Sourdough requires a lengthier fermentation process, which can be tricky to manage in a school kitchen area. Some colleges have resolved this by partnering with nearby bakeries, but this Option will not be possible in all areas.
